Dave,

Do you have a smartset to locate the NetView server (I think it is
'isManager=TRUE')?  If not, build one and see what shows up, if
anything, this should locate your NetView Server if it is in the map at
all.

I remember something similar happening to me before, I deleted the
NetView server from the database by mistake and it would not discover it
until I ran a complete rediscovery and that got it back into the
managerSubmap.

Hi All,
       Im upgraded a netview server from 4.3.3 AIX  Netview 6.0.3   to
5.2.0.0-02 AIX  Netview 7.1.4 FixPack2.  I changed the hostname and IP
address of this server and I think I missed something. For some reason
this
server does not show up on the map 'ManagerSubmap'      I can do a
nslookup
on the IP and the Hostname and it resolves. I can ping and snmpwalk the
server.  The server is also in the host and seed file. Where can I find
instruction for changing the IP address and Hostname? I have done a
reset_ci also...
